Step-by-step explanation:
The Law of Cosines can help you figure this out. Call the given sides "a" and "b" and the given angle "C". Then the third side, "c" will satisfy the relation ...
c² = a² + b² -2ab·cos(C)
= 33² +37² -2·33·37·cos(120°) = 3679
c = √3679 ≈ 60.65476 ≈ 60.65
The length of the third side is about 60.65 units.
